Welcome to crime data report for Bowman, Georgia, an area with a population of 917 residents. In this data exploration, we will delve into the crime statistics of Bowman, Georgia shedding light on its safety and security. The closest law enforcement agency from Bowman is Hart County Sheriff's Office (GA0730000) approximately around 10.95 miles away from the center of Bowman.

This analysis uses the latest crime data submitted by Hart County Sheriff's Office to the FBI National Incident-Based Reporting System (NIBRS).

Note: In area with small number of population such as Bowman, the data might be skewed in infrequent crimes such as homicide, rape, and arson.

Total Crime in Bowman, Georgia

A comprehensive overview of the overall crime landscape, covering a range of different criminal activities within a specific region.

Chart of Total Crime in Bowman, Georgia from 2012 to 2022

The trend in Bowman exhibited an upward pattern, with the lowest point occurring in 2019 (223.49) and the peak reached in 2016 (373.39). In Georgia, the crime rate displayed a decline in, peaking in 2013 (4551.94) and bottoming out in 2020 (1614.53). In United States, the crime rate displayed a decline in, peaking in 2013 (3519.17) and bottoming out in 2021 (1689.67).

With a -91.04% lower total crime rate than the state average (297.65 vs 3322.76), Bowman demonstrated commendable safety. A -89.78% lower total crime rate compared to the national average (297.65 vs 2912.43) highlights positive community efforts.

Property Crime in Bowman, Georgia

Encompassing various crimes against property, such as theft, burglary, motor vehicle theft, and arson, this data highlights incidents of possession-related offenses.

Chart of Property Crime in Bowman, Georgia from 2012 to 2022

The trend in Bowman exhibited a declining pattern, with the peak occurring in 2013 (2773.7) and the bottom point reached in 2019 (841.65). In Georgia, the crime rate displayed a decline in, peaking in 2013 (4105.03) and bottoming out in 2020 (1343.97). The crime rate in United States demonstrated a decreasing trend, reaching its peak in 2013 (3094.35) and then reaching its lowest level in 2021 (1408.44).

With a -45.13% lower property crime rate than the state average (1614.73 vs 2942.75), Bowman demonstrated commendable safety. A -35.58% lower property crime rate compared to the national average (1614.73 vs 2506.49) highlights positive community efforts.
